DESCRIPTION:This is an expository talk about a deep probability inequality
  due to Talagrand (Invent. Math. 1996\, cf. Ledoux's book in 2001)\, which
  gives a Prohorov- (and then also Bernstein-) type exponential bound for t
 he concentration of the supremum of an empirical process around its mean. 
 I will try to discuss the following points: A) Some ideas of the proof\, i
 n particular the proof due to Ledoux using logarithmic Sobolev inequalitie
 s\, which is related to the more general "concentration of measure" phenom
 enon. B) Discuss a variety of probabilistic applications\, which should sh
 ow how versatile this inequality is\, in particular that it reproduces mos
 t known exp. inequalities for i.i.d. sums of (possibly Banach-)valued rand
 om variables. C) Discuss recent statistical applications to adaptive estim
 ation\, model selection problems\, Rademacher processes\, and almost sure 
 limit laws (LIL-type results).
